Fat soluble Vitamins Molecules that the body cannot make itself Dissolve in fat Must consume in/with fat Needed as take part both in metabloism and to act as hormones
Role of Fat Soluble Vitamins These vitamins have a different role in metabolism than the Water Soluble Vitamins Need for roles like hormones eg Vit A, D Needed for involvement in physiological functions eg Vit E, K and A (in vision)
Vitamin D Function Need to allow Calcium uptake stimulates production of Calcium Binding Proteins (CBP) this allows uptake of calcium from the gut , bone and urine
Vitamin D has to be activated before it can work Vit D works together with Parathyroid Hormone (PTH) Too little Vit D causes extra PTH PTH is a vasoactive and Causes blood vessels to constrict and High blood pressure
Deficiencies RicketsInfantsvery bad in china still • OsteomalaciaAdults • OsteoporosisOlder adults • hypertensionEffects every one • More in higher latitudes where less sun • More important than too much salt
Source of Vitamin D Made in the Skin form Cholesterolneed UV light more deficiency in higher latitudes(Victoria. > Queensland)Vit. D3 made in skin (Called pro Vit D) Must be oxidised in Lung then Kidney to produce Active Vit. D ( DHCC)

Vitamin A (Retinol) Needed to form Visual purple in the retina of eye Hormonal action regulates cell differentiation Immune system Blood cells skin hair Embryonic development Cancer
Deficiencies of Vitamin A Deficiency permanently blinds some 250,000 children a year. Infectious Childhood illnesses, contributing to 30% of the deaths of under 5 yo.s Vitamin A supplementation could prevent 1 to 3 million child deaths each year . Blindness linked with diarrhoea The lack of vitamin also results in diarrhoea and other infections. These repeated attacks of diarrhoea may bring about the final eye damage which destroys sight.==>Unable to absorb Vit A
Sources of Vitamin A b - carotene(yellow Pigment in plants) Converts into Vit. A Liver, eggs, butter, margarines, fish oil Green and red vegetables
Vitamin E Natural Anti-oxidant Stops production of Free Radicles Free radicles react with many compounds DNA - mutations Phosphlipids - membrane fracture Ageing
Source of Vitamin E Wheat germ Unprocessed vegetable oils Nuts Green vegetables
Vitamin K Need for blood clotting formation of prothrombin Sources: Fats and Oils Vegetables Intestinal bacteria
